Aims and objectives

  • Provide patients with a standard of care we would expect to receive ourselves.
  • Communicate with patients in a friendly, open, courteous and professional manner.
  • Keep our knowledge and professional skills up to date.
  • Listen to, and act on, patient views and opinions.
  • Ensure that patients receive full information about our services, their treatment options and associated costs.
  • Refer patients for further advice where appropriate.
  • Respect patient confidentiality at all times.
  • Abide by the most recent standards of cross-infection control.
  • Make our complaints procedure known and available.
  • Actively seek patient feedback to ensure our services meet patients' needs and expectations.

By doing this we hope to provide the opportunity for patients to fully participate in their oral healthcare in a safe, supportive environment. The patient's wishes and best interests will always be at the centre of our treatment planning process.

Complaints

Here at GL1 Dental, we always aim to have satisfied patients and consistently meet the expectations of our patients in the care and service we provide. When complaints do arise, we aim to resolve the issues in an appropriate and timely fashion. Throughout any complaint handling procedure, the patient's confidentiality is of utmost importance and is observed at all times. We respect the individual's right to make a complaint and will ensure that they are in no way discriminated against as a result of raising their concerns.

In the unfortunate event that you wish to make a complaint, please speak to a member of staff at reception at the earliest possible occasion. You will then be directed to our complaints lead (TODO(client): name and role), who oversees all of our complaint handling procedures. Complaints can be made verbally, by phone on 01452 905185, or by email to hello@gl1dental.co.uk. In writing: FAO Complaints Lead, GL1 Dental, 124–126 Stroud Road, Gloucester GL1 5JN.

An acknowledgement of your complaint will be made within two working days of it being received, and a brief history of your complaint will be taken at that point. Usually, some time will then be needed to investigate. You should let our complaints manager know if you do not want the treating dentist to be informed or involved at this stage. We aim to resolve all complaints within ten working days from receipt, but where the issue is likely to take longer to investigate, we will let you know at the earliest possible time, giving reasons for the expected delay. You will then be contacted with the findings of our investigation and invited to attend a meeting to discuss possible options for resolution. If you are not satisfied with the outcome of our complaints procedure, you should contact one of the following bodies:

Privacy and dignity

All staff are trained on their responsibilities for safeguarding patient privacy and keeping information secure, in line with current legislation:

  • We will not share confidential information you have given us, or that we hold about you, with anyone else without first obtaining your agreement.
  • Information collected for one reason will not be reused for a different reason unless you have agreed to this.
  • You may object at any time to us using your confidential information for anything beyond your direct care.
  • Our duty of confidentiality continues after a patient has died and is upheld to the same standard as for living patients.
  • Whenever information is shared with another person or organisation, our disclosure rules are applied without exception.

To ensure patient dignity is protected, we implement our equality and diversity policy by:

  • Providing patient information in a variety of languages, if required.
  • Making translation services available for patients who need them.
  • Providing services that are accessible to patients with disabilities.
  • Ensuring care is planned around each individual's specific needs.
  • Working proactively to reduce oral-health inequalities across the communities we serve.
  • Bringing patients and patient groups into how we shape and improve our service.
  • Meeting the varied needs and circumstances of our patients and local community with a positive approach.
  • Coordinating with other services supporting patients who have additional medical or social-care needs.
